Parmesan Cottage Fries

Potatoes are roasted with mushrooms, tomatoes, bell pepper, and Parmesan cheese in this cottage fries side dish that's very versatile.

Preparation Time
20 mins
Cooking Time
40 mins
Total Time
60 mins
Calories
238 Calories

Recipe Instructions

Step 1
Roast in the preheated oven for 25 minutes.
Step 2
Preheat oven to 450 degrees F (230 degrees C). Grease a 10x15-inch glass baking dish.
Step 3
Spread potatoes into the baking dish; drizzle olive oil on top. Sprinkle Parmesan cheese and 1 garlic clove over potatoes.
Step 4
Melt butter in a large skillet over low heat; season with 1 garlic clove, salt, pepper, and garlic-herb seasoning. Add mushrooms, tomatoes, bell pepper, and onion. Cook and stir until softened, about 5 minutes.
Step 5
Remove baking dish from the oven. Flip potatoes and stir in mushroom mixture.
Step 6
Return baking dish to the oven; continue roasting until potatoes are slightly browned, about 15 minutes more.

Ingredients

  • 2 tablespoons butter
  • salt and ground black pepper to taste
  • 1 cup grated Parmesan cheese
  • 1 green bell pepper, cut into large chunks
  • 3 Roma tomatoes, diced
  • 2 tablespoons olive oil, or to taste
  • 2 cloves garlic, chopped, divided
  • 6 potatoes, cut into 1/2-inch cubes
  • 1 pinch garlic and herb seasoning blend (such as Mrs. Dash®)
  • 12 large mushrooms, quartered
  • 1 slice onion
